Ryan Orr is a MiLB Strength and Conditioning Coach in the Los Angeles Angels organization. He played NAIA baseball and shoulder injuries derailed his career which led him to wanting to pursue a job where he could help people avoid the same problems he faced as an athlete. He received his masters degree from the University of Arkansas where he helped out with the Men's Basketball team. While at Arkansas, he was also volunteering with the Northwest Arkansas Naturals, a Double-A Affiliate of the Kansas City Royals. After spending some time as the Interim Head Strength Coach for the Men's Basketball team, he took a full time job with the LA Angels. In this episode, we dive deep into Ryan's background and how sports influenced his life growing up. We talk about some of the major similarities and differences between the college setting and the professional setting as well as the similarities and differences of baseball and basketball. Finally, we get into the characteristics that high performers share opposed to non-high performers and he talks about his stance on bench press for baseball players.
